From: [EMAIL PROTECTED] Found this on teletext tonight Gold Medal Sparks Debate Britain's latest Olympic gold medal celebrations have sparked a new debate over shooting and the Dunblane tragedy. Hampshire based Richard Faulds took the gold in a clay pigeon shoot-out against Australia's Russell Mark. Sports Minister Kate Hoey, a close friend of the marksman, fuelled the debate over Britain's new gun laws by saying the sport was "misunderstood". What new debate?
